As of MacPorts 2.6.0, 10.6-10.8 also use libc++ by default.
We had neglected to notice that we needed to rebuild sparsehash after that
transition. That's now done in [18a1b6b37472aa4a717e03e70a51cac3b6fe1590
/macports-ports].
Since textmate2 already requires 10.8 or later, this issue should no
longer exist.
